「制御プロトコル」とはどういう意味ですか?
目次
コントロールプロトコルは、複数のエージェントやシステムが一緒に動くときの振る舞いを管理するためのルールや方法のセットを指すんだ。エージェントはロボットや車両なんか何でもありで、目的を達成するためにうまく連携することが目標だよ。
コントロールプロトコルの種類
エージェントが行動について合意に達する速さに基づいて、いくつかの種類のコントロールプロトコルがあるんだ。主な2つは:
-
有限時間コンセンサス(FTC):これはエージェントが特定の時間内に行動について合意することを意味してて、早く決断しないといけないときには便利だよ。
-
固定時間コンセンサス(FXC):この場合、エージェントは条件や妨害があっても、定められた時間内で合意に達することができるんだ。
コントロールプロトコルの課題
こういったプロトコルを設定する際には、考慮すべき課題があるんだ:
- エージェントは自分の正確な位置や方向を常に把握しているわけではない。
- 互いのやりとりの強さが異なるため、エージェントによっては協力の仕方が違うかもしれない。
これらの課題に対処することで、コントロールプロトコルは全てのエージェントが同じ方向を向いてスムーズに協力できるようにするんだ。